Hinson Announces IA-01 Congressional Art Competition Winner
Washington, D.C. - Congresswoman Ashley Hinson (IA-01) today announced that Alleesandra Brown of Cedar Rapids is the winner of the 2021 Congressional Art Competition. Alleesandra is a rising sophomore at Washington High School in Cedar Rapids. Her piece is titled A Wonderland of UnCanny and will hang in the U.S. Capitol alongside other selections from around the country.
"I am so honored to congratulate Alleesandra on winning this year's competition," said Congresswoman Hinson. "This is such an exciting opportunity to showcase Alleesandra's talent. I look forward to seeing her piece hang in the U.S. Capitol all year long."
The annual Congressional Art Competition is an opportunity to recognize and encourage young artists in high school for their talents. Each spring, students submit original artwork to their representative's office and one winner is chosen to display their piece at the U.S. Capitol for a year alongside other students' works from across the nation.
